2014-05-08mmc-utils: fix compilation failure for mips64 target.Chen Qi
This patch fixes mmc-utils compilation failure for qemumips64. Remove the 'include <asm-generic/int-ll64.h>' line from mmc.h, because this file is automatically included if _MIPS_SZLONG is not 64, otherwise, <asm-generic/int-l64.h> is included. Expicitly including <asm-generic/int-ll64.h> will cause the compilation failure for mips64 target. 2014-05-08python3: Revert python-config to distutils.sysconfigTyler Hall
The newer sysconfig module shares some code with distutils.sysconfig, but the same modifications as in 12-distutils-prefix-is-inside-staging-area.patch makes distutils.sysconfig affect the native runtime as well as cross building. Use the old, patched implementation which returns paths in the staging directory and for the target, as appropriate. 2014-05-08distutils.bbclass: only modify *.py file if it contains path to be removedRadek Dostal
Currently sed command touches every single *.py file. This modifies the timestamp of the file. All *.pyo files will be recompiled during the first boot, because timestamp will not match. This should be only necessary if sed command changes the file. Signed-off-by: Radek Dostal <radek.dostal@streamunlimited.com> Signed-off-by: Saul Wold <sgw@linux.intel.com>

2014-05-06kernel-yocto: quote kconfig mode checkBruce Ashfield
We allow inheriting recipes to control the kconfig mode used by merge_config.sh via the KCONFIG_MODE variable. An error crept into the variable reference, and since it is not quoted, the true condition always runs. The result is that operations without an explicit kconfig mode cannot trigger allnoconfig for defconfig builds, which can result in some options being dropped from the final .config. Quoting the reference allows it to evaluate properly. Signed-off-by: Bruce Ashfield <bruce.ashfield@windriver.com> Signed-off-by: Saul Wold <sgw@linux.intel.com>
